Appendix 4C - December 2021 Quarter

Attached is the 4C for the December 2021 Quarter. We would like to draw your attention to the cash flow from operations set out in the 4C and specifically part 1.8 relating to the transfer of funds available for redraw by NHF under the terms of the PFG funding facility, to an account under PFG's control.

In previous periods the balance of the redraw account was recorded, in the 4C reports, as NHF cash held and included in the balances of trapped cash as detailed in note 8.6. During this reporting period the Redraw Account of $2.2m was transferred to a PFG Controlled account, in accordance with the terms of the facility. In this current reporting period the balance of the PFG Redraw Account has been offset against the PFG debt balance in note 7.
